  1/4 n extremely low offset : 150v/ max. n low input bias current : 1.8na n low v io drift : 0.5v/c n ultra stable with time : 2v/month max. n wide supply voltage range : 3v to 22v description the op07 is a very high precision op amp with an offset voltage maximum of 150v. offering also low input current (1.8na) and high gain (400v/mv), the OP07C is particularly suitable for instrumentation applications. order code n = dual in line package (dip) pin connections (top view) part number temperature range package n OP07C -40c, +105c n dip8 (plastic package) 1 2 3 4 8 6 5 7 v cc v cc inverting input non-inverting input output offset null 2 offset null 1 n.c. OP07C very low offset single bipolar operational amplifier november 2001
